There’s been one prosecution in Kerry so far this year, with a total of 730 complaints made to Kerry County Council regarding the environment.

Details show that between January and May, 487 litter complaints were made, with 46 fines issued, 17 fines paid to date, but there have been no court prosecutions.

When it comes to waste, 144 complaints have been investigated so far by the council, resulting in one prosecution with a court award of €875.

There have been 34 complaints related to air and 65 about water, but none of these have resulted in court prosecutions.
